XSS in Tp-link Tl-wr840n
CVE-2019-12195
TP-Link TL-WR840N v5 00000005 devices allow XSS via the network name. The attacker must log into the router by breaking the password and going to the admin login page by THC-HYDRA to get the network name. With an XSS payload, the network n…
Vulnerability class: XSS (Cross-Site Scripting)
EPSS: 0.018 (75.9th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.
CVSS v3 metric
CVSS v3 base score 4.8 (Medium). Vector: C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:H/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N.
Affected products
- Tp-link Tl-wr840n — versions 5.0
- Tp-link Tl-wr840n_firmware — versions 0.9.1_3.16
